"Dance of Fire and Steel"

Johnsy and I found ourselves surrounded by menacing Devils. "Chu Chu!" Johnsy's telepathic call urged me into action, knowing that the more Devils we defeated, the more delightful feasts awaited her.

With a nod, I Rosie from the concealing bushes, and Johnsy materialized by my side. She was my trusted partner, a magical being dwelling within me, and we shared a strong fellowship. "You distract one while I handle the other," I directed her calmly.

Steeling my resolve, I gripped my sword tightly as I stepped into the open. The devil monkey had only departed moments ago, leaving behind a restless pack of iron rhinos still seething with anger.

These were young iron rhinos, Mark 1 Professional Devils, each measuring an impressive two meters in width.

Their rusty iron appearance was intimidating, and the sharp horn on their heads posed a deadly threat. Their tough hide made them challenging opponents, only suitable for seasoned evolvers at the Lv1 Professional stage or higher.

But we had a plan. The reason I chose to confront these iron rhinos was their most significant weakness - their sluggish speed. This vulnerability made them easy targets for the devil monkey's harassment, and we aimed to exploit it to our advantage.

As I cautiously approached one of the iron rhinos, Johnsy used her magical abilities to distract the other, causing it to turn its attention away from me. My heart pounded in anticipation as I analyzed the creature's movements, searching for any opening to strike.

With a swift and precise motion, I lunged forward, targeting a vulnerable spot on the iron rhino's hide. My blade found its mark, and the Devil bellowed in pain, but it wasn't going down without a fight. Its massive body swung towards me, its horn poised to retaliate.

Meanwhile, Johnsy gracefully weaved her magic, skillfully evading the other iron rhino's attacks. She sent dazzling bursts of energy at it, further confusing the creature and buying me the time I needed to focus on my opponent.

In this dangerous dance of combat, we relied on each other's strengths and instincts. Our synchronicity was uncanny, a true testament to our fellowship as partners. As I continued my calculated strikes, Johnsy's telepathic encouragement fueled my determination.

Gradually, we wore down the iron rhinos, exploiting their lack of agility to outmaneuver and outwit them. With every successful attack, we inched closer to victory. As the last iron rhino fell, the forest around us fell silent, and a sense of accomplishment washed over us.

Together, we had conquered the formidable iron rhinos, proving that unity and understanding could overcome even the most daunting challenges. As we prepared to venture deeper into the mysterious world of Talaria, I knew that with Johnsy by my side, there was no Devil too fearsome, and no obstacle too great for us to conquer.
